Organic Product
A molecule synthesized by an organic reaction, typically consisting primarily of carbon and hydrogen atoms, along with other elements such as oxygen, nitrogen, sulfur, or halogens.
Nucleophilic Addition
A fundamental type of reaction in organic chemistry where a nucleophile forms a bond with an electrophile, typically resulting in the addition of the nucleophile to a carbon atom.
Carbonyl Group
A functional group composed of a carbon atom double-bonded to an oxygen atom (C=O), central to many organic reactions.
